I've always been a migraine sufferer-first sign is when vision in one eye starts to go. If I take paracetamol immediately at that point it's controlled.

What concerns me is the frequency of them; I've had three in four days. I'm almost 9 weeks pregnant.

I suffer from health anxiety and this is making it so much worse!

Anybody else had similar?

Migraines tend to either increase or not happen at all in pregnancy. I suffer from horrendous migraines and have had a couple this pregnancy so I think mine have actually decreased. They all happened in the first trimester so they might calm down for you in time. You can only take paracetamol but I’ve found having a can of full fat coke with the paracetamol really helps for some strange reason. My midwife recommended it. X
